>From Ayush Tripathi <[email protected]>:
Ayush Tripathi has uploaded this change for review. (
https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/19134 )
Change subject: [ASTERIXDB-3503][EXT] Throwing Delta format is not supported
error for given external source type.
......................................................................
[ASTERIXDB-3503][EXT] Throwing Delta format is not supported error for given
external source type.
- user model changes: yes
- storage format changes: no
- interface changes: no
Ext-ref: MB-64314
Change-Id: I350ba8ceddff554c2b0407449ce00b336715f92d
---
M
asterixdb/asterix-external-data/src/main/java/org/apache/asterix/external/util/ExternalDataUtils.java
1 file changed, 19 insertions(+), 0 deletions(-)
git pull ssh://asterix-gerrit.ics.uci.edu:29418/asterixdb
refs/changes/34/19134/1
diff --git
a/asterixdb/asterix-external-data/src/main/java/org/apache/asterix/external/util/ExternalDataUtils.java
b/asterixdb/asterix-external-data/src/main/java/org/apache/asterix/external/util/ExternalDataUtils.java
index 19c1979..b915c83 100644
---
a/asterixdb/asterix-external-data/src/main/java/org/apache/asterix/external/util/ExternalDataUtils.java
+++
b/asterixdb/asterix-external-data/src/main/java/org/apache/asterix/external/util/ExternalDataUtils.java
@@ -523,7 +523,12 @@
tableMetadataPath = S3Constants.HADOOP_S3_PROTOCOL + "://"
+
configuration.get(ExternalDataConstants.CONTAINER_NAME_FIELD_NAME) + '/'
+
configuration.get(ExternalDataConstants.DEFINITION_FIELD_NAME);
+ } else {
+ throw new CompilationException(ErrorCode.EXTERNAL_SOURCE_ERROR,
+ "Delta format is not supported for the external source
type: "
+ +
configuration.get(ExternalDataConstants.KEY_EXTERNAL_SOURCE_TYPE));
}
+
Engine engine = DefaultEngine.create(conf);
io.delta.kernel.Table table = io.delta.kernel.Table.forPath(engine,
tableMetadataPath);
try {
--
To view, visit https://asterix-gerrit.ics.uci.edu/c/asterixdb/+/19134
To unsubscribe, or for help writing mail filters, visit
https://asterix-gerrit.ics.uci.edu/settings
Gerrit-Project: asterixdb
Gerrit-Branch: goldfish
Gerrit-Change-Id: I350ba8ceddff554c2b0407449ce00b336715f92d
Gerrit-Change-Number: 19134
Gerrit-PatchSet: 1
Gerrit-Owner: Ayush Tripathi <[email protected]>
Gerrit-MessageType: newchange